What is the difference between a meteorologist and atation model?

A meteorologist is a scientist who studies and predicts the weather, while a station model is a symbolic diagram used on weather maps to represent weather conditions at a specific location. Meteorologists use station models to quickly convey information about temperature, pressure, wind speed, and other weather variables at a glance.

How could a meteorologist use a station model to determine whether a cold front is approaching?

A meteorologist can use a station model to identify key indicators of a cold front approaching by analyzing temperature, dew point, wind direction, and pressure changes. Typically, a sharp drop in temperature and a shift in wind direction to the north or northwest, along with a rising barometric pressure, suggest that a cold front is advancing. Additionally, the presence of precipitation symbols and changes in cloud cover on the model can further confirm the front's approach. By comparing these elements across multiple station models, a meteorologist can assess the location and intensity of the approaching cold front.
